Output d5a17a1497845c3fe79c0f320e2c9196eb5adc063af22dae0ff4e2a300fd4ba1:33

value
1093654
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be750a319aef99c73c22206c662cc3ff283cb76 OP_EQUALVERIFY OP_CHECKSIG
address
1M3k64NFECao3E3PKwAaKvqcD1fn1H5kjA
transaction
d5a17a1497845c3fe79c0f320e2c9196eb5adc063af22dae0ff4e2a300fd4ba1
spent
true